However, randomized clinical trials have confirmed that newer agents, such as terbinafine and fluconazole (Diflucan), have equal effectiveness and safety and shorter treatment courses1416 (Table 4).2,12,1720 Terbinafine may be superior to griseofulvin for Trichophyton species, whereas griseofulvin may be superior to terbinafine for the less common Microsporum species.21,22 Culture results are usually not available for two to six weeks, but 95% of tinea capitis cases in the United States are caused by Trichophyton, making terbinafine a reasonable first choice.23 However, kerion should be treated with griseofulvin unless Trichophyton has been documented as the pathogen.2,17 Failure to treat kerion promptly can lead to scarring and permanent hair loss.2, Microsize (Grifulvin V suspension): 20 to 25 mg per kg per day; single daily dose or two divided doses (maximum: 1 g per day), Ultramicrosize (Gris-Peg tablets): 10 to 15 mg per kg per day; single daily dose or two divided doses (maximum: 750 mg per day), Microsize: $44 ($165) for 300 mL of 125-mg-per-5-mL solution, Ultramicrosize: $263 ($430) for 60 250-mg tablets, No baseline testing in absence of liver disease, If required for longer than eight weeks, ALT, AST, bilirubin, and creatinine measurements and CBC every eight weeks2,17, Six to 12 weeks (continue for two weeks after symptoms and signs have resolved)2, 25 to 35 kg (55 lb to 78 lb): 187.5 mg once daily, CBC at six weeks for courses lasting longer than six weeks, Six weeks; longer for Microsporum infections, Assume Trichophyton unless culture reveals Microsporum, Daily dosing: 6 mg per kg per day for three to six weeks, Tablets: $100 for 30 150-mg tablets ($1,185 for 90 50-mg tablets), Suspension: $33 ($290) for 35 mL of 40-mg-per-mL suspension, Approved for children older than six months for other indications, Baseline ALT, AST, and creatinine measurement and CBC, Capsules: 5 mg per kg daily for four to six weeks, Solution: 3 mg per kg daily for four to six weeks, Pulse therapy with capsules: 5 mg per kg daily for one week each month for two to three months, Pulse therapy with oral solution: 3 mg per kg daily for one week each month for two to three months, Solution: NA ($265) for 150 mL of 10-mg-per-mL solution, Capsules: $102 ($590) for 30 100-mg capsules, Apply daily to affected nail and adjacent skin; remove with alcohol every seven days, 40 kg (89 lb) or more and adults: 250 mg daily, Approved for children older than four years for tinea capitis, ALT and AST measurement, CBC at six weeks, Six weeks for fingernails; 12 weeks for toenails, Approved for adults and children older than six months for other indications, Baseline ALT, AST, alkaline phosphatase, and creatinine measurements, CBC, 12 to 16 weeks for fingernails; 18 to 26 weeks for toenails. A Wood lamp examination may be helpful to distinguish tinea from erythrasma because the causative organism of erythrasma (Corynebacterium minutissimum) exhibits a coral red fluorescence. Tinea versicolor (now called pityriasis versicolor) is not caused by dermatophytes but rather by yeasts of the genus Malassezia. The sensitivity of the KOH preparation varies widely in different settings, ranging from 12% in a study of 27 Flemish general practitioners to 88% in a Nova Scotia tertiary care center 41 (Table 510,11,29,30,4148 ). The diagnosis of onychomycosis should usually be confirmed with a KOH preparation, culture, or PAS stain because the treatment is long and potentially expensive, and the nonfungal mimics are common.27 In one study, less than 50% of dystrophic toenails resulted in positive fungal cultures.28 However, the involvement of multiple toenails, or accompanying tinea pedis, may justify treatment without confirming the diagnosis.29 The most sensitive diagnostic test, and the most expensive, is the PAS stain,30 which can be performed by placing toenail clippings or curettings in 10% formalin and transporting them to the pathology laboratory.
